Template:Infobox Location This desert in the southwest corner of the Vale is also known as the graveyard of dragons. No one knows why these beasts came here to die in such large numbers. Some say those same dragons left behind great treasures upon their death, but few have dared to venture too far in these wastes to find out.[1]

Trivia
- The original name for Wyrmsands may have been Bloodsands, as seen in an early version of the Grand Tour journal entry.
